#157a2d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#157a2d is composed of 8.2% red, 47.8%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.1%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 134.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 28%. #157a2d color hex could be obtained by blending #2af45a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

● #157a2d color description : Dark lime green.
#157a2d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#157a2d has RGB values of R:21, G:122,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 1407533.
